Diablo 4 Expansion Postponed Until 2026

by Harper Feb 23,2025

Diablo 4 fans anticipating a new expansion in 2025 will need to adjust their expectations. Diablo general manager Rod Fergusson recently announced at the DICE Summit that the next major expansion won't arrive until 2026.

Fergusson highlighted Blizzard's commitment to improved community engagement, mirroring the strategies of Diablo Immortal and World of Warcraft by implementing content roadmaps. A roadmap detailing Diablo 4's 2025 plans, including seasonal updates, is expected soon. However, the 2026 expansion will not be included in this roadmap. He stated, "In 2025, or just before Season 8, we will have a 2025 roadmap for Diablo 4. Our second expansion won't be on that roadmap, because our second expansion is coming in 2026, but at least players will have the road ahead."

While Fergusson didn't elaborate extensively on the reasons for the delay, he offered insights. Blizzard's initial plan called for annual expansions, with Vessel of Hatred in 2024 and a subsequent expansion in 2025. However, Vessel of Hatred's release was pushed back to 18 months post-launch instead of the intended 12 months. This delay, Fergusson explained, stemmed from the team's responsiveness to player feedback and adjustments to live content. These adjustments temporarily diverted resources from Vessel of Hatred, causing internal delays and subsequently impacting the timeline for future content.

Diablo 4 recently launched its Season of Witchcraft, introducing significant new witchcraft abilities, a fresh questline, and more.
